One area that OnePlus are not afraid to try is new ideas and innovations. Since the days of the OnePlus 3 they have incorporated the, "OnePlus Laboratory", in their firmware with a view to trying out new features for ordinary users as this is in addition to their forthcoming, "Open Beta", firmware programme.

The same applies to the OnePlus 6T. You can access the, "OnePlus Laboratory", by going to...

Settings > Utilities > OnePlus Laboratory

Here you can currently find, "Smart Boost", for you to test and which they describe as follows...

"Based on your daily usage, Smart Boost takes full advantage of the large RAM of OnePlus phones, which improves the performance when loading apps and games"
